Preparation and Identification of Monoclonal Antibodies against Recombinant Truncated P Protein of Canine Distemper Virus

Hongfei Zhu

Open publisher page 0 citations

Abstract

The assay was aimed to prepare monoclonal antibodies(McAbs) against P1 protein of canine distemper virus(CDV).BALB/c mice were immunized with P1 protein and the immunized mice spleen myeloma cells were fused with SP2/0.Two hybridoma cell lines of E9E4C10 and E9F8D9 that stably produced antibodies against protein were identified by ELISA.The antibody titres of ascites for the hybridoma lines were both 1∶106.The subtypes of monoclonal antibodies were both identified as IgG2b.Western blotting and IFA showed that the McAbs specifically recognized certain antigenic epitopes of P1 protein of CDV.Additive index of ELISA competitive binding assay indicated that the two monoclonal antibodies were specific for different epitopes.The McAbs prepared in this study were useful tools for developing immunological diagnosis techniques of CDV and investing P protein function.
